Type
ORACLE
Validation date
2024-06-11 03:56: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01747,
    "usd": 0.01881
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001300330712D8A68E08050B9F7AFDF58736EDE1818D634528D380E3C2A9BB3C852

Previous signature

FC40990CDC2DFAFED930B1DF700EC2B240D2DE180AF21CBC42F8175EBE0589BB841F67446EAFD4DC80608B1BDC45D6B19DF50FDCA12B806FF7E761D8E0FF8507

Origin signature

304602210083AA93E2F7F3B790F63A902C3C1FDF41D5060654E13D39AF7A9EB9A459EE871F0221008259E549AAAF102CCE264BC126E7A43E61368AA8ED99CA63DA5DEC64A41CA63F

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

00D779D37D067802DDAF8A4F0EBCA83D672C387DFDCE6D73983DF6C5FBB4959F98

Coordinator signature

760C061CF7F9310DF71573BDF8FFEA09A87B76B43F5B8B55F45B1A7AF6B109553A6405940082FB2D7AF2CD4F9DB58FFF71DBF7C9FC848BF5CEBDEE492B1EF50D

Validator #1 public key

00011967662C70D5F9CEC676DEA17401E35B7987C8D9D43FAB1E6FC27D8B08C88EED

Validator #1 signature

106D648BCAF3048538C6DB816B6CB3F5B9E54F199C45B336EE39BA04F302214AEBD90A18A8CEBBAACCB82F93A267425CD88D413564F0107E423860F14F42DE09

Validator #2 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#2 signature

EB94D2C705CCC9A6396BF30F36E4167A70B0503194D7BB1513AF39A9BEE401F0EEBAB9703CC7BCEEB1605CAA48C2F41F97285A0523A974548E4869C600686F0D